Defining Diffusion00:00:23

Diffusion is defined as the net movement of particles from an area of higher concentration to lower concentration. It is a passive process driven by the kinetic energy of particles, continuing until equilibrium is reached.

Simple vs. Facilitated Diffusion00:01:46

Simple diffusion allows small, non-polar molecules to pass directly through the phospholipid bilayer. Conversely, facilitated diffusion uses channel or carrier proteins to assist polar or larger molecules in crossing the membrane.

Factors Affecting the Rate of Diffusion00:03:49

The rate of diffusion is influenced by temperature (higher energy increases movement), the steepness of the concentration gradient, the total surface area of the membrane, and the density of channel or carrier proteins available.
